If Michigan's electric utilities were allowed to use marginal cost pricing, it would lead to economic profits for these utilities. Is the previous statement correct or incorrect? Explain your answer.
 
  What will be an ideal response?

Answer to Question 1

The statement is incorrect. Imposing marginal cost pricing on natural monopolies results in the firms incurring economic losses not economic profits.
